Unyielding Thermal Control


This mini heat gun delivers a rated power of 300W, operating within an output temperature range of 230°C to 380°C. The wind volume is specified between 200-450 litres per minute. These specifications are clearly visible on the product itself and in accompanying informational graphics.

Such a focused power output and adjustable temperature range are crucial for applications where excessive heat or uncontrolled airflow would cause damage. It prevents scorching delicate materials or over-shrinking components. This tool ensures that heat is applied precisely, preventing collateral damage to adjacent parts or surfaces.

Enduring Construction


The construction of this mini heat gun features a durable red plastic casing with a ribbed texture for improved grip, as observed in the product images. The nozzle is black, indicating a heat-resistant material, and the power cord is robustly integrated into the handle. A small, foldable metal bracket is also visible, designed to allow the gun to stand upright when not in active use.
